Transaction 677ecb3f9ee7b4cbe41eeb42f59719df094bb53a078f9e8652490fc20ce653df
1 Input
1 Output
-
677ecb3f9ee7b4cbe41eeb42f59719df094bb53a078f9e8652490fc20ce653df:0
- value
- 210535539
- script pubkey
- OP_0 OP_PUSHBYTES_20 e5e8a95a010808f57df9fff0110f51f28c6e81e7
- address
- bc1quh52jksppqy02l0ellcpzr6372xxaq08zl99zx